- Yanıt formatı nelerdir?
- III. Beklenmeyen cevap biçimlerinin sebepleri nedir?
- II. Yanıt formatının beklenmedik olması ne demektir?
- 5. Beklenmeyen cevap formatlarını ele almamanın riskleri nedir?
- 6. Beklenmeyen cevap formatı nelerdir?
- VII. Beklenmeyen cevap biçimlerinin önlenmesi
- VIII. Beklenmeyen cevap biçimlerini ele almanıza destek olacak kaynak yok
Urban Utopia, ütopya olarak önde gelen bir şehirdir. İnsanların birbirleriyle ve çevreyle ahenk içerisinde yaşamış olduğu bir yerdir. Kabahat, fakirlik ve kirlilik yoktur. Hepimiz sevinçli ve memnundur.
Urban Utopia’da birçok mahalli çekicilik merkezi bulunmaktadır. En popüler olanlardan bazıları şunlardır:
- Botanik Bahçeleri
- Hayvanat Bahçesi
- Sanat Müzesi
- Bilim Merkezi
- Planetaryum
Bu ilginç bölgeler ziyaretçilere naturel dünyayı öğrenme, dünyanın dört bir yanından hayvanları görme ve sanat ve bilimi deneyimleme şansı sunar. Ek olarak dinlenmek ve tabiatın güzelliğinin tadını çıkarmak için mükemmel bir yerdir.
Urban Utopia’ya bir seyahat planlıyorsanız, bu mahalli gezinsel bölgeleri ne olursa olsun ziyaret edin. Ziyaretinizi unutulmaz kılacaklarından güvenilir olabilirsiniz.
Antet | Hususiyet |
---|---|
Kentsel ütopya | Muhteşem ya da ülkü olarak önde gelen bir kent |
Yerel çekicilik merkezleri | Bir şehirde görülecek ve yapılacak şeyler |
Saadet | Aşırı saadet ya da kıvanç hali |
Yolculuk rehberi | Muayyen bir yere yolculuk ile alakalı data elde eden kitap ya da internet sayfası |
Kent rehberi | Muayyen bir kent ile alakalı data elde eden kitap ya da internet sayfası |
Yanıt formatı nelerdir?
Bir cevap biçimi, verilerin bir internet servisinden döndürülme şeklidir. En yaygın cevap biçimleri JSON ve XML’dir.
III. Beklenmeyen cevap biçimlerinin sebepleri nedir?
Bir cevap biçiminin beklenmedik olmasının birçok sebebi vardır. En yaygın nedenlerden bazıları şunlardır:
İstemci ve sunucu protokolün aynı sürümünü kullanmıyor. Bu, sunucunun istemcinin beklemediği bir cevap biçimi göndermesine niçin olabilir.
İstemci ve sunucu değişik karakter kümeleri kullanıyor. Bu, sunucunun istemcinin yorumlayamayacağı bir cevap biçimi göndermesine niçin olabilir.
Sunucu, istemci tarafınca desteklenmeyen bir cevap biçimi yolluyor. Bu, sunucunun istemcinin tanımadığı yeni ya da deneysel bir protokol kullanımı niteliğinde gerçekleşebilir.
İstemci geçerli olmayan bir arzu yolluyor. Bu, sunucunun istemcinin beklediği cevap biçimini göndermemesine niçin olabilir.
Sunucu geçici bir hata yaşıyor. Bu, sunucunun istemcinin beklediği cevap biçimini göndermemesine niçin olabilir.
II. Yanıt formatının beklenmedik olması ne demektir?
Beklenmeyen bir cevap biçimi, beklediğiniz şekilde olmayan bir yanıttır. Bu, aşağıdakiler benzer biçimde muhtelif nedenlerle olabilir:
- Sunucu yanlış yapılandırılmış ve yanlış formatı yolluyor.
- Alan kişi yanlış formatı istek ediyor.
- Veriler aktarım esnasında bozuluyor.
Bir cevap biçimi beklenmediğinde, uygulamanız için sorunlara niçin olabilir. Örnek olarak, uygulamanız cevap verilerini ayrıştıramayabilir ya da verileri yanlış ayrıştırabilir. Bu, uygulamanızda hatalara ya da hatta emniyet açıklarına yol açabilir.
Probleminin nedenini belirlemek ve düzeltmek için beklenmeyen cevap biçimlerini gidermek önemlidir. Bu, uygulamanızın muntazam çalıştığından ve saldırılara karşı savunmasız olmadığından güvenilir olmanıza destek olacaktır.
5. Beklenmeyen cevap formatlarını ele almamanın riskleri nedir?
Beklenmeyen cevap formatlarını ele almazsanız karşılaşabileceğiniz bir takım risk vardır. Bu riskler şunları ihtiva eder:
Veri kaybı: Muayyen bir cevap biçimini beklemiyorsanız, verileri doğru halde ayrıştıramayabilirsiniz. Bu, veri yitirilmesine ya da bozulmasına yol açabilir.
Emniyet ihlalleri: Muayyen bir cevap biçimi beklemiyorsanız, verileri muntazam bir halde doğrulayamayabilirsiniz. Bu, çapraz site betik çalıştırma (XSS) saldırıları benzer biçimde emniyet ihlallerine yol açabilir.
Performans sorunları: Muayyen bir cevap biçimi beklemiyorsanız, beklenmeyen verileri işlemek için ek mantık uygulamanız gerekebilir. Bu, artan rötar ya da azalan verim benzer biçimde performans problemlerine yol açabilir.
Kullanıcı deneyimi sorunları: Muayyen bir cevap biçimi beklemiyorsanız, kullanıcılarınız verilerle etkileşim kurmaya çalıştıklarında problemler yaşayabilirler. Bu, kullanıcı hayal kırıklığına ve kullanıcı memnuniyetinin azalmasına yol açabilir.
6. Beklenmeyen cevap formatı nelerdir?
Beklenmeyen bir cevap biçimi, istemci tarafınca beklenen şekilde olmayan bir yanıttır. Bu, aşağıdakiler benzer biçimde muhtelif nedenlerle olabilir:
- Sunucu, istemcinin beklediğinden değişik bir şekil döndürecek halde yapılandırılmış.
- İstemci, sunucunun desteklemediği bir şekil için arzu yolluyor.
- Sunucuda geçici bir hata var ve beklenen formatı döndüremiyor.
VII. Beklenmeyen cevap biçimlerinin önlenmesi
Beklenmeyen cevap biçimlerini önlemek için yapabileceğiniz birkaç şey var.
Standart HTTP yöntemlerini kullanın. Bir internet servisine istekte bulunurken standart HTTP yöntemlerini (GET, POST, PUT, DELETE) kullanın. Bu, beklediğiniz şekilde bir cevap aldığınızdan güvenilir olmanıza destek olacaktır.
İçerik Türü başlığını kullanın. Bir internet servisine arzu gönderirken İçerik Türü başlığını ilave edin. Bu antet sunucuya isteğin hangi şekilde bulunduğunu söyler.
Cevap biçimini doğrulayın. Bir internet servisinden cevap aldığınızda, yanıtın biçimini doğrulayın. Bu, şu benzer biçimde bir çalgı kullanılarak yapılabilir: [JSONLint](https://jsonlint.com/) ya da [XMLLint](https://www.xmllint.org/).
Bu ipuçlarını takip ederek beklenmeyen cevap biçimlerinin önüne geçebilirsiniz.
Misal:
Aşağıdaki kod, Content-Type başlığının JSON formatında bir arzu göndermek için iyi mi kullanılacağını göstermektedir.
POST https://api.example.com/users
İçerik Türü: application/json
{
“isim”: “John Doe”,
“e-posta”: “[email protected]”
}
Aşağıdaki kod, bir JSON yanıtının cevap formatının iyi mi doğrulanacağını gösterir.
$ curl https://api.example.com/users | jsonlint -f
Şayet yanıt geçerliyse jsonlint aracı aşağıdakine benzer bir bildiri yazdıracaktır.
JSON geçerlidir
Şayet yanıt geçersiz ise jsonlint aracı aşağıdakine benzer bir bildiri yazdıracaktır.
JSON geçersiz: Sözdizimi yanlışı: Beklenmeyen belirteç ‘x’
VIII. Beklenmeyen cevap biçimlerini ele almanıza destek olacak kaynak yok
Beklenmeyen cevap biçimleriyle başa çıkmanıza destek olacak şu anda kullanılabilir kaynak bulunmamaktadır.
Bu makalede, beklenmeyen cevap biçimleri terimini ele aldık. Beklenmeyen cevap biçiminin ne işe yaradığını tanımladık ve beklenmeyen cevap biçimlerinin nedenlerini ve neticelerini inceledik. Ek olarak, beklenmeyen cevap biçimleriyle başa çıkmak için en iyi uygulamaları sağladık ve beklenmeyen cevap biçimlerini ele almamanın risklerini ele aldık. En son, beklenmeyen cevap biçimlerini ele almanıza destek olabilecek kaynaklar sağladık.
Bu yazının beklenmeyen cevap biçimleri terimini anlamanıza destek olmasını umuyoruz. Herhangi bir sorunuz ya da yorumunuz var ise lütfen bizimle iletişime geçmekten çekinmeyin.
Kentsel ütopya nelerdir?
* Kentsel ütopya, muhteşem ya da ülkü olarak önde gelen bir şehirdir. İnsanların birbirleriyle ve çevreyle ahenk içerisinde yaşamış olduğu bir yerdir.
Kentsel bir ütopyada mahalli çekicilik merkezleri nedir?
* Kentsel bir ütopyada birçok ihtimaller içinde mahalli çekicilik merkezi vardır. Birtakım örnekler içinde parklar, müzeler, tiyatrolar ve restoranlar bulunur.
Mutluluğun anlamı nelerdir?
* Saadet, muhteşem bir saadet ya da sevinç halidir. Memnun ve doygunluk olmuş olma hissidir.
0 Yorum